Launch of the Sixth Taigei Submarine "Sougei"

Summary by Marineforum
While ten of the twelve Soryu boats (84 meters, 4,200 tons dipped) are still equipped with Saab Kockums' external air independent drive and only the last two of the series were equipped with lithium-ion batteries from 2020 onwards, the Taigei boats developed from this class (85 meters, 4,300 tons) are exclusively battery-powered.
